About SIREN:
SIREN is an award winning team of producers and supervisors who love music and the craft of storytelling through sound. SIREN collaborate with a global network of composers, artists, musicians, labels and publishers to provide the strongest musical solutions available.
SIREN has extensive experience in supervision, composition, re-records, music research, sync negotiation & licensing across a range of media including advertising, film & podcasts.
SIREN is based in central London and is part of the Factory Family.
The Role:
This is a full time role.
Our office is based in central London but we all enjoy flexible working so happy to discuss this.
You will be leading your own projects from inception to final delivery (developing a concept, taking a brief, music research, sourcing composers, finding a track, editing to picture, creating guide mixes, organising live recordings, negotiating & licensing).
You will be a team player and enjoy collaborating with others, both within the team and externally. This strong collaborative culture allows us to find the best possible musical solutions for any project.
You will already have a strong track record of finding new artists and composers to work with / nurture and enjoy sharing these new discoveries with the team.
New business is a key component of the role; you will bring with you your own network of clients from agencies / production companies and brands and we will introduce you to others and you should feel excited about continuing to develop and expand this network.
The initial focus will be on advertising with the intention that you will develop into other areas of the business.
– Leading the music supervision process across client campaigns and projects.
- Negotiating deal points and contracts
- Overseeing budgets
- Organising live recordings
- Creating music edits to picture
- Attending industry events
- Continuing to nurture existing client / composer / rights holder relationships
- Introducing new clients and composer talent to the team
- Sourcing rights information
- Contributing ideas for social media output & thought pieces
